bowl, combine the sugar, oil and eggs. Stir in A to Z ingredients of your choice and vanilla. Combine flour, cinnamon, baking powder, baking soda and salt; stir into liquid ingredients just until moistened. Stir in nuts. Pour into two greased 8x4-in. loaf pans."},{"@type":"HowToStep","text":"Bake at 350° for 50-55 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Cool for 10 minutes before removing from pans to wire racks."}],"recipeYield":"2 loaves","author":[{"@type":"Person","name":"Taste Recipes Editorial Team"}],"nutrition":{"@type":"NutritionInformation","calories":"","fatContent":"","cholesterolContent":"","sodiumContent":"","carbohydrateContent":"","fiberContent":"","proteinContent":""},"aggregateRating":{"@context":"http:\/\/schema.org\/","@type":"AggregateRating","ratingValue":4.5454545,"reviewCount":22,"worstRating":1,"bestRating":5},"review":[{"@context":"http:\/\/schema.org\/","@type":"Review","datePublished":"2021-10-26","author":{"@context":"http:\/\/schema.org\/","@type":"Person","name":"2124arizona"},"reviewBody":"A very versatile bread.
